 Definitions

 Glucose syrup: A purified concentrated aqueous solution of nutritive saccharides


obtained from starch and/or inulin.

 Dextrose: An alternative name of glucose and it is often mean Corn Syrup which
contains glucose and dextrins.

 Dextrins: Dextrins are mixture of soluble compounds formed by partial breakdown
of starch by heat or acid or enzyme.

 Dextrose equivalent value (DE): is a term used to indicate the degree of hydrolysis
of starch into glucose syrup it is defined as a total reducing sugar content expressed
as dextrose and calculated as a % of sugar content as a dry solids and the more DE
number mean higher sugar content and less dextrins. Glucose syrup has a dextrose
equivalent content of not less than 20.0 % m/m (expressed as D-glucose on a dry
basis), and a total solids content of not less than 70.0 % m/m.

 Requirements
Glucose syrup shall meet the following requirements:

 It shall be viscous and odourless, with a characteristic sweet taste.

 It shall be clear, free from sediments, or any other extraneous matter, that you see
with the naked eye.

 It shall be colourless, or of a faint yellow colour.

 It shall be free from fermentation and mouldy growth.

 Raw materials used in its manufacture shall be conform to there related GSO
standards.

 Total solids shall not be less than 70% (mm).

 Dextrose equivalent shall not be less than 20% (m/m) calculated on a dry basis.

 Protein shall not exceed 0.1%, calculated on a dry basis.

 Sulphated ash shall not exceed 1% calculated on a dry basis.

 Sulphur dioxide in glucose syrup used in manufacturing confectionery shall not
exceed 400 ppm and it shall not exceed 40 ppm in glucose syrup used in other food
manufacturing.

 Sulpour Dioxie shall not more than 20 mg/Kg

 It shall not contain contaminating metallic elements exceeding the quantities
specified in the following:

Arsenic 1 ppm

Copper 5 ppm

Lead 2 ppm

 The product shll be free from low quality converted starch.

 Sampling
The following shall be met during sampling.

 The pump shown in Fig. 1 shall be used and it shall be clean and dry when used.

 Precaution shall be taken to protect the contamination of samples, sample


containers, and sampling instrument.

 The sample shall be placed in a clean glass container and shall be sealed air-tight
and marked with full details of sample, date of sampling, date of manufacturing,
name of manufacturer or other important information about consignment.

 Sample shall be stored in a manner that the conditions of storage do not unduly
affect the quality of the material.

 If the consignment consists of different batches of manufacture, the containers


belonging to the same batch shall be grouped together, and one container from
each batch shall be selected as a representative sample.

 Producer

- Place the ample in a clean and dry place, clean the lid of the container and the area
round with soap and water. Wipe the cleaned area and dry.

- Removed the lid and take out with a ladle the material to remove the top scum, if
any.

- Insert the pump with its piston locked in position on the container and very slowly
press the pump down to the extent of the upper one-third height of the container.
Hold the pump in this position of five minutes.

- Again very slowly press the pump down through the middle one-third height of
the container and hold the pump in that position for five minutes.

- Press the pump down again very slowly and when it touches the bottom of the
container, raise it a little so that it is just above the bottom of the container. Allow
the pump to remain in that position for five minutes (the pump will have been
filled in by this time).

4
GSO STANDARD GSO DS 1310 / 2016

- Take out the pump and wipe its outside surface so as to remove the glucose syrup
which may be adhering to it.

- Unlock the piston and work it upward movement, simultaneously collecting the
flowing out of the spout in a clean and dry container.

- Repeat the operation of drawing glucose syrup in the above manner, until a
quantity of about 2 kg of the sample is collected in the container.

- Thoroughly mix the sample and divide it into three equal parts, each part being not
less than 0.6 kg.

- Thoroughly place the three samples in clean and dry containers, and seal them air-
tight.

- Label each container with the information given in 5.3.

- One of the samples shall be sent to the laboratory and one to the vendor, and the
third shall be kept as a reference sample.

 Packing, Transportation And Storage


The following shall be met during packing, transportation and storage and without
prejudice to what have been mentioned in the Gulf standards in items (2.7) and
(2.8).

 Packing

It shall be packed in a clean, sound, suitable, dry and leakproof containers.

 Transportation

Transportation shall be carried out in such a way so as to protect containers from


mechanical damage and contamination.

 Storage

The packed product shall be stored in well-ventilated stores and far from sources
of heat, moisture and contamination.

 Labelling
Without prejudice to what has been mentioned in the Gulf standard in item (2.1),
the following specific provisions apply on each container:

 Product name

If the glucose syrup contains fructose above 5% it shall bear a description to


reflect this.

 Manufacturing date by month and year in non-coded manner.

 Batch number.

 Using purpose.

 Product classified according to Dextrose equivalent (DE).
